It is for the love of the trees that we dedicate ourselves to creating work which will honor them. Never Stop Building is a design build studio located in Mercer, Maine. We specialize in traditional woodworking, furniture design, timber framing and finish carpentry, utilizing predominantly Japanese tools and techniques. We believe that by building high quality, long lasting goods from sustainable materials will both reduce our impact on the environment and improve the quality of our lives and that of our children and grandchildren.
